A pet care organization in Fenny Compton is seeking an apprentice to support canine physiotherapy treatments. The role involves maintaining a clean environment, preparing equipment, and caring for dogs. Ideal candidates will have a love for animals, good communication skills, and GCSEs in Maths and English.

The apprenticeship offers hands-on experience within a specialist setting with opportunities for progression to Level 3 Animal Care or full-time employment.
